What will you be doing?
As a Marketing Operations Analyst, Your Responsibilities Will Include
- Support Automation: Assist in automating marketing and lead management workflows to improve efficiency and scalability, ensuring alignment with business goals and reporting needs.
- Optimize and Document Lead Processes: Enhance lead lifecycle processes like enrichment, scoring, routing, and conversion rate optimization, working with stakeholders to improve lead quality and funnel efficiency.
- Marketing Budget Administration: work with marketing team to administrate master Americas marketing budget within Allocadia.
- Marketing Project Coordination: Assist with keeping the marketing team on track by managing projects within Asana
- Support stakeholder partners through reporting and analyses to measure the success of their programs
- Partner with Sales Analytics to scale the lead generation funnel and define SLAs between Marketing and Sales.
- Support procurement process: help marketing team with administrative processes related to our internal procurement process.
- Harness marketing and sales automation platforms and CRM systems for the management and analysis of marketing data. (ex. Outreach and 6sense)
- Establish and maintain scalable processes that ensure best practices in marketing efforts to revenue impact.
- Ensure consistency in asset classification and maintenance across North America marketing assets.
We look for people who value agility, passion and teamwork; those who can bring fresh ideas to the table and want the opportunity to learn, grow, and expand their careers. Bring your aptitude and build upon what you do best for our customers, partners, team, and you.
Other qualities you’ll need to be a fit for this role include:
- Experience: 2+ years of experience in a related role with a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
- Technical Skills: Strong understanding of lead processes and routing within marketing platforms (e.g., Marketo, Dynamics CRM, 6sense). Experience with marketing data analysis and reporting is essential.
- Data-Driven: Analytical mindset with a proven ability to track and report on lead performance, identifying key trends and actionable insights.
- Detail-Oriented: Ability to document and maintain clear processes and reporting structures and ensure data accuracy across the marketing funnel.
- Collaborative: Strong inter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to work effectively across marketing, sales, and technical teams.
- Adaptable: Comfortable working in a fast-paced, dynamic environment with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ple projects at once.
